Job Description SummaryGE HealthCare develops and sells digital solutions, broadening its portfolio with analytics and clinical offerings that help support customers on their digital journey, bringing more value to their imaging platforms.
GE HealthCare is seeking a Senior Associate, Digital Service Operations where you will lead the technical aspects of installation and ongoing support of all products in the Imaging Digital Solutions (IDS) portfolio. You're responsible for remotely deploying and support IDS offerings, engaging with Project Managers, onsite customers, GEHC Field support, and GEHC engineering to ensure a world class customer experience wing-to-wing.

Job DescriptionEssential Responsibilities:
  • Lead execution of remote installation processes of the IDS solutions across the US and Canada. 

  • Communicate complex technical issues in a customer-friendly manner.

  • Initiate and support remote connections to customer sites and installation of the different components of IDS.

  • Work with Project Managers and on-site Field Engineers on site-specific planning unique to each customer’s infrastructure availability and project status.

  • Ensure close collaboration and communication with the Project Management teams, customers, on-site GEHC field support and GEHC engineering on the status and plans for assigned installations.

  • Support and execute major / minor upgrades of new releases.

  • Drive timely resolution of all assigned technical issues within the installed base.

  • Provide feedback to product and engineering teams to improve the installation process and efficiency on existing product and new product introductions.

  • Lead and contribute to the problem resolution process (best-available-troubleshooting procedure development and improvement, investigation & resolution/workaround implementation)

  • Provide feedback on Technical Documentation, including Installation and Service Manuals.

What you need to know about the Seattle Tech Scene

Home to tech titans like Microsoft and Amazon, Seattle punches far above its weight in innovation. But its surrounding mountains, sprinkled with world-famous hiking trails and climbing routes, make the city a destination for outdoorsy types as well. Established as a logging town before shifting to shipbuilding and logistics, the Emerald City is now known for its contributions to aerospace, software, biotech and cloud computing. And its status as a thriving tech ecosystem is attracting out-of-town companies looking to establish new tech and engineering hubs.

Key Facts About Seattle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 287,000; 13%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Amazon, Microsoft, Meta,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, software, biotechnology,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Madrona, Fuse, Tola, Maveron
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of Washington, Seattle University, Seattle Pacific University, Allen Institute for Brain Science,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ation, Seattle Children’s Research Institute
